Josep Garcia is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Pharmaceutical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Josep Garcia has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 476 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 3 papers in Pharmaceutical Science. Recurrent topics in Josep Garcia’s work include T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(5 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(5 papers) and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(3 papers). Josep Garcia is often cited by papers focused on T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(5 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(5 papers) and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(3 papers). Josep Garcia collaborates with scholars based in Spain, France and Belgium. Josep Garcia's co-authors include Xavier Domènech, Juan Casado, José Peral, Alexandre Rodrigues Tôrres, Carmen M. Domínguez, Miguel Á. Galán, Meritxell Teixidò, Ernest Giralt, Michael E. Webb and Oscar Céspedes and has published in prestigious journals such as Advanced Drug Delivery Reviews, Journal of Controlled Release and Chemosphere.
